What Makes a Sponge Mattress the Best Choice for Comfort?
Sponge mattresses are often regarded as the best choice for comfort due to their unique support and pressure-relieving properties.
- Pressure Relief
- Support and Spinal Alignment
- Durability
- Motion Isolation
- Temperature Sensitivity
- Material Variations
Sponge mattresses provide several key attributes that contribute to their popularity, as well as some differing opinions on their overall effectiveness.
-
Pressure Relief:
Pressure relief in sponge mattresses refers to their ability to distribute body weight evenly, reducing pressure points. The softness of the sponge allows it to conform to body shape. According to the Sleep Foundation, better pressure relief can lead to less discomfort and lower risk of pressure sores. Studies have shown that people with chronic pain conditions often prefer sponge mattresses for this reason. For instance, a 2019 study by the Journal of Pain Research found significant improvements in comfort levels for patients using sponge mattresses. -
Support and Spinal Alignment:
Support and spinal alignment in sponge mattresses ensures that the spine maintains a neutral position during sleep. Quality sponge mattresses provide adequate support through their density and structure. The American Chiropractic Association emphasizes the importance of proper spinal alignment to avoid pain and discomfort. Mattresses that conform to the body’s contours help maintain this alignment. A clinical trial published in the Journal of Orthopaedic & Sports Physical Therapy in 2017 demonstrated that proper spinal support reduces back pain incidents by 35%. -
Durability:
Durability in sponge mattresses indicates their lifespan and resistance to wear and tear. High-quality sponge materials can maintain their shape and performance over years of use. The average lifespan of a sponge mattress is around 8 to 10 years. An investigation by Consumer Reports highlights that premium sponge mattresses show less degradation compared to traditional spring mattresses. -
Motion Isolation:
Motion isolation refers to a mattress’s ability to absorb movement, preventing disturbances when one partner shifts or gets out of bed. Sponge mattresses excel in this regard, making them ideal for couples. A study in the Journal of Applied Physiology (2018) indicated that mattress types significantly affect sleep quality, with sponge mattresses causing fewer sleep interruptions due to their motion-absorbing properties. -
Temperature Sensitivity:
Temperature sensitivity refers to how sponge materials respond to body heat. Some sponge mattresses may retain heat, causing discomfort for some sleepers. However, many modern designs incorporate cooling technologies, such as gel-infused sponges, to mitigate heat retention. Research published in the International Journal of Sleep Science highlights that mattress temperatures can influence sleep quality, emphasizing the importance of selecting a sponge mattress with appropriate temperature management features. -
Material Variations:
Material variations in sponge mattresses include different types of sponge, such as memory foam and latex, each offering distinct advantages. Memory foam provides high contouring ability, while latex offers a more resilient feel. A survey conducted by the Better Sleep Council in 2020 showed that preferences varied significantly based on individual comfort needs, demonstrating the importance of testing different materials for optimal sleep satisfaction.
How Do Cooling Technologies Enhance the Performance of a Sponge Mattress?
Cooling technologies enhance the performance of a sponge mattress by regulating temperature, improving comfort, and promoting better sleep quality.
-
Temperature regulation: Cooling technologies use materials such as gel-infused memory foam or phase change materials. These materials absorb excess heat and release it when the body cools down, maintaining a comfortable sleep temperature. A study in the Journal of Sleep Research (Hirshkowitz et al., 2015) found that temperature regulation is essential for deep sleep cycles.
-
Enhanced comfort: Cooling technologies provide a softer feel and contouring support. For example, gel-infused sponges distribute body weight evenly. This reduces pressure points that can lead to discomfort. Research published in the International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health (Lee et al., 2020) indicates that better pressure distribution increases sleep satisfaction.
-
Improved breathability: Many cooling technologies incorporate breathable materials. These materials allow air to circulate, preventing heat buildup. Increased airflow helps prevent excessive sweating, creating a drier and more comfortable sleep surface. The American Institute of Physics (2018) emphasizes that breathability in mattress materials significantly impacts overall sleep quality.
-
Moisture management: Some cooling technologies include moisture-wicking fabrics. These fabrics draw sweat away from the body, enhancing comfort and reducing nighttime disturbances. A study in Sleep Health (Dewald-Kaufmann et al., 2014) noted that minimizing moisture increases sleep duration and quality.
-
Longevity and durability: Cooling technologies often contribute to mattress longevity. Advanced materials resist degradation over time, maintaining their cooling properties longer. Consumer Reports (2021) highlights that durable mattresses, including those with cooling technologies, require fewer replacements, leading to a better long-term investment.
These features of cooling technologies collectively enhance the overall performance of a sponge mattress, resulting in improved sleep quality and comfort.
What Firmness Levels Should You Consider When Buying a Sponge Mattress?
When buying a sponge mattress, consider firmness levels like soft, medium, and firm to find the best fit for your comfort and support preferences.
- Soft Firmness
- Medium Firmness
- Firm Firmness
- Pressure Relief
- Sleeping Position Compatibility
- Personal Preference
- Weight Considerations
Firmness levels vary based on individual needs and sleeping styles.
-
Soft Firmness: Soft firmness provides a plush feel. It suits side sleepers as it contours to the body’s curves. A study by the National Sleep Foundation indicates that side sleepers benefit from softer mattresses, reducing pressure points on shoulders and hips.
-
Medium Firmness: Medium firmness offers balanced support. It accommodates combination sleepers who change positions during the night. According to a 2021 survey by the Sleep Research Society, most sleepers reported improved comfort on medium-firm mattresses.
-
Firm Firmness: Firm firmness gives strong support. It is suitable for back and stomach sleepers to maintain spinal alignment. The American Chiropractic Association asserts that a firm mattress can help prevent back pain by keeping the spine in a neutral position.
-
Pressure Relief: Pressure relief is crucial for reducing discomfort. Mattresses that offer adequate pressure relief help prevent aches, especially for those with joint issues. A review in the Journal of Clinical Pain found that adequate pressure-relieving qualities significantly improved sleep quality.
-
Sleeping Position Compatibility: Compatibility with sleeping positions matters. Different positions require specific firmness levels for optimal support. A study by the Sleep Foundation highlights that side sleepers fare best on softer mattresses, while back and stomach sleepers prefer firmer options.
-
Personal Preference: Personal preference is subjective. Factors like past experiences and individual comfort levels influence choices. The Better Sleep Council states that individual comfort should be a paramount factor when selecting mattress firmness.
-
Weight Considerations: Weight affects firmness perception. Heavier individuals may sink deeper into a mattress, necessitating a firmer option to avoid feeling trapped. Research from the International Sleep Products Association shows that mattress firmness impacts comfort differently based on a person’s weight.
Understanding firmness options and how they align with personal preferences and sleep styles leads to more informed purchasing decisions regarding sponge mattresses.

What Materials Are Essential in High-Quality Sponge Mattresses?
High-quality sponge mattresses typically consist of a combination of materials that enhance comfort, support, and durability.
- High-density foam
- Memory foam
- Natural latex
- Polyurethane foam
- Gel-infused foam
- Cover fabrics (e.g., cotton, polyester, bamboo)
These materials differ in properties and user experiences, creating diverse perspectives on their effectiveness in a sponge mattress. Some may prefer natural latex for its eco-friendliness and durability, while others may opt for memory foam for its body-conforming comfort. Additionally, consumers often debate between gel-infused foam for its cooling properties versus traditional foam for cost-effectiveness.
-
High-Density Foam: High-density foam serves as the foundational layer in many sponge mattresses. This material provides essential support and helps maintain the mattress’s shape over time. High-density foam is durable, typically lasting longer than other foam types. According to a study by the Sleep Foundation, this type of foam can improve sleep posture by offering robust support.
-
Memory Foam: Memory foam is known for its ability to contour to the sleeper’s body. This material adapts to pressure and heat, creating a unique fit for each individual. The American Academy of Sleep Medicine notes that memory foam can help reduce pressure points, leading to more restful sleep. However, some users report insufficient airflow in traditional memory foam, resulting in heat retention.
-
Natural Latex: Natural latex is derived from rubber trees and is celebrated for its durability and breathability. It offers a responsive feel and helps in reducing motion transfer, making it suitable for couples. Research by The Journal of the International Society of Sports Nutrition highlighted that latex can provide a balance between comfort and support. Furthermore, it is often considered a more environmentally friendly option.
-
Polyurethane Foam: Polyurethane foam is widely used in budget-friendly mattresses. It can vary in density and firmness, making this material versatile for different preferences. This type is often less durable than high-density foam and can break down over time. Specific formulations, such as open-cell polyurethane, can offer better breathability than traditional versions.
-
Gel-Infused Foam: Gel-infused foam incorporates cooling gel beads designed to counteract heat retention. This material enhances temperature regulation, making it ideal for hot sleepers. Studies suggest that people using gel-infused mattresses experience improved sleep quality due to better temperature control.
-
Cover Fabrics: The outer cover of the mattress plays a crucial role in overall user experience. Fabrics like cotton, polyester, and bamboo can affect breathability and moisture-wicking properties. Cotton is often favored for its softness, while bamboo fabric can provide antibacterial properties. The choice of fabric can significantly influence the perceived comfort and hygiene of the mattress.
